springboot 收藏
时间: 2023-10-23 16:47:32 浏览: 38
以下是一些有用的 Spring Boot 学习资源和教程:
1. 官方文档:Spring Boot 的官方文档是学习 Spring Boot 的最好资源之一,它提供了全面的文档和示例代码。
2. Spring Boot 极简教程:这是一份简洁易懂的 Spring Boot 教程,它提供了一些简单的示例代码和解释。
3. Spring Boot 入门教程:这篇入门教程详细介绍了如何使用 Spring Boot 进行 Web 开发。
4. Spring Boot 实战教程:这是一篇基于实战的 Spring Boot 教程,它包含了大量的实例和代码。
5. Spring Boot 系列教程:这是一系列 Spring Boot 教程,从入门到进阶,逐步深入讲解 Spring Boot 的各个方面。
6. Spring Boot 项目实战教程:这个项目实战教程涵盖了 Spring Boot 中的许多主题,如数据库访问、安全性、测试等。
7. Spring Boot 视频教程:这是一些免费的 Spring Boot 视频教程,可以帮助您更好地理解 Spring Boot 的工作原理。
8. Spring Boot 中文文档:这是 Spring Boot 的中文文档,包含了大量的实例和解释,是学习 Spring Boot 的好资源之一。
希望这些资源能够帮助您快速入门 Spring Boot,并成为一个优秀的 Spring Boot 开发者。
相关问题
springboot实现收藏
收藏功能可以通过SpringBoot实现,以下是实现的步骤:
1. 设计数据库表结构
可以创建一个favorites表,包含以下字段:
- id: 收藏记录的唯一标识符
- user_id: 收藏用户的id
- article_id: 被收藏文章的id
- create_time: 收藏时间
2. 创建收藏实体类
根据数据库表结构,创建一个Favorites实体类,并使用JPA注解进行映射。
3. 创建收藏服务类
创建一个FavoritesService类,实现收藏的一些基本操作,如添加收藏、取消收藏、查询收藏等。
4. 创建控制层
创建一个FavoritesController类,处理收藏相关的请求,如添加收藏、取消收藏、查询收藏等。
5. 编写前端页面
设计并编写前端页面,使用户能够进行收藏操作。
6. 集成Spring Security
为了保护收藏功能的安全性,可以集成Spring Security,对用户进行认证和授权,确保只有授权的用户才能进行收藏操作。
通过以上步骤,就可以实现SpringBoot的收藏功能了。
springboot+vue收藏功能
实现收藏功能,可以考虑以下步骤:
1. 在后端编写收藏功能的接口,可以使用SpringBoot框架来实现。首先需要设计出收藏表的数据结构,可以考虑两个表:一个是用户表,另一个是收藏表。收藏表可以记录用户收藏的信息,包括收藏的类型、收藏的对象ID、收藏的时间等信息。用户表可以记录用户的基本信息,包括用户名、密码、邮箱等信息。
2. 在前端编写收藏功能的界面,可以使用Vue框架来实现。需要设计出一个收藏按钮,当用户点击该按钮时,可以调用后端编写的接口来实现收藏功能。在前端界面上,可以显示用户已经收藏的内容,并提供取消收藏的功能。
3. 实现收藏功能的业务逻辑。当用户点击收藏按钮时,需要调用后端编写的接口。后端接口首先需要判断用户是否已经收藏该内容,如果已经收藏,则返回提示信息;如果未收藏,则将该内容添加到收藏表中,并返回成功信息。当用户点击取消收藏按钮时,后端接口需要将该内容从收藏表中删除。
4. 在前端界面上,可以使用localStorage或者cookie来存储用户已经收藏的内容。当用户再次访问该页面时,可以从localStorage或者cookie中读取用户已经收藏的内容,并显示在页面上。
以上就是实现收藏功能的基本步骤,具体实现细节需要根据具体的业务需求进行调整。